What is the off season for Branson MO?

The off-season in Branson MO occurs during January, February, and March, the chilly winter months that bridge the gap between Christmas and springtime. Although some shows and sites are closed during the off-season, there are still many attractions to enjoy and savings to relish. Plus, the lack of crowds is refreshing.

What are winters like in Branson MO?

Branson can have freezing temperatures from October to April, averaging 98 frosty nights a year. One night typically drops to 0 °F (-18 °C) or below. Normally for 11 days a year the thermometer never rises above freezing. Days that chilly can occur here from November to March, and are most common in January.

Does it snow in Branson MO?

Snow in Branson is possible from November to February, but usually no more than two inches at a time. Branson sees snow only three to five times each winter, and it usually melts quickly once the sun comes out.

Is Branson dangerous?

With a relatively small population of 11,589, Branson tallied 85 violent crimes in 2018. The breakdown of those violent crimes came to 65 aggravated assaults, 10 robberies, and 10 rapes. In comparison, property crimes totaled 1,244, with 999 of them falling under larceny/theft.

Can you drink in Branson MO?

In Branson, a city in Taney County, Missouri, packaged alcoholic beverages may be sold between 9:00 a.m. and midnight on Sunday, and between 6:00 a.m. and 1:30 a.m., Monday through Saturday.

Is Wheaton a dry town?

As the U.S. emerged from prohibition in 1933, Wheaton residents voted the following year to keep the town dry, fearing that alcohol could carve away at the city’s religious core. In the early 1960s, the city council officially allowed alcohol possession.
